[PATCH v2 3/3] Linux: Add tests that check that TLS and rseq area are separate
Florian Weimer
fweimer@redhat.com
Mon Jan 13 12:33:10 GMT 2025
The new test elf/tst-rseq-tls-range-4096-static reliably detected
the extra TLS allocation problem (tcb_offset was dropped from
the allocation size) on aarch64. It also failed with a crash
in dlopen *before* the extra TLS changes, so TLS alignment with
static dlopen was already broken.
